Be Better Than Ourselves (A Father's Prayer)



My child
Be better than ourselves
Your mother and I
Learn the mysteries of life, learn the secrets
Deep rich creamy chocolate
Rolling thunder pitch black
Spring rain, autumn leaves in the
Secret dwelling places of our lives
My child
Be better than ourselves
Your mother and I
Learn the history of your life, learn the beauty
Blue, gold, brown
Trading spaces on foreign ground
Pink, yellow, grey
The beauty and joy of you entering into this space
Orange, sparkling red
Bright white energy in the struggle ahead
Violet, purple hue, midnight sky, silver stars
Swirling in the knowledge pool
My child
Be better than ourselves
Your mother and I
Learn the happiness of freedom found
In the deep reaches and accesses of your mind
True freedom ring and then, you can do anything!
Red, black, green
The color of blood, skin, land in the world scene
Beige, rust, touch
Hidden away in a land called trust
Hold close at hand, do not ever forget a
Righteous man's stand
Walk proud and tall, always sing a joyous song
Give thanks to God for keeping you warm
Lion heart, purple-green a suffering scene in life's scheme
Pride cometh before the fall, eventually it happens to us all
Warm and safe in a baby's dream
A cotton candy cloud, soft and sweet, taking on a hue of pink
Forest thick, deep, dark, cool, dense, unrelenting
Cascading out of the knowledge pool
Teach one; reach one, make your life complets!
My child
When I ask
"Be better than ourselves
No shame, no pain just a prayer for a legacy gain to
Improve our strain to
Place a mark on this world of great beauty with
A 'Southern' name
Living a life with your head held high
Knowing no one can ever touch the red-orange fire burning in
Keep you head to the sky!
With a feather fluff touch of a hand
Always walk with a straight and narrow stand
Lifting your arms to the Heavens
Breathing deep rich expansive joy as all your tomorrow's explode For
All to feel and explore
My child
Be better than ourselves
Your mother and I
Candy apple, cherry red passion the final call the
Final extension
A gold mist swirling in white
Flamingo pink sides making you smile just right
Yellow sky, blue glow atop a waxy mask
Dripping scented opium rosebuds
A true sign, a sexual repast
Picking orchids in a field
Whispering sweet nothings in an ear
Living life to the full, loving someone not being cruel
Having babies two maybe three
Can you feel it?
Enriching the world with
Kings and Queens!
Only then my child can you dream of
Being better than ourselves!
